Superstar Rajinikanth's highly anticipated action thriller, 'Coolie,' is already making massive waves in the pre-release market, with its Telugu theatrical rights reportedly acquired for a staggering ₹45 crore. This significant deal, secured by prominent producers Asian Suniel Narang, Suresh Babu, and Dil Raju, underscores the immense buzz surrounding the Lokesh Kanagaraj directorial in the Telugu-speaking states.
'Coolie,' which promises to showcase the 70-year-old Tamil superstar in a power-packed action role, is slated for a grand worldwide release on August 14th. The film has generated considerable excitement not just in its home state of Tamil Nadu, but also across major Telugu territories, leading to this record-setting rights acquisition. While formalization of the deal is still pending, it is poised to become one of the most expensive agreements for any Tamil film in the Telugu market.
'Coolie' is set for a multi-lingual theatrical release, extending beyond its original Tamil version. It will also be released in Hindi, targeting audiences particularly in Northern India. Recently the makers has released Hindi title poster for the film, renamed as 'Majadoor' for Hindi-speaking audiences.
The film is reportedly being made on a colossal budget of ₹350 crores. This impressive figure includes the individual remunerations of both director Lokesh Kanagaraj and Superstar Rajinikanth. Exclusive reports suggest that Rajinikanth is receiving an upfront pay cheque of ₹150 crores, marking one of the highest fees ever for an actor. Lokesh Kanagaraj, on the other hand, has reportedly commanded a fee of ₹50 crores, a significant achievement for a filmmaker, reflecting his rising stature in the industry.
